This is a safety alert symbol and should never be ignored.
When you see this symbol on labels or in manuals, be alert
to the potential for personal injury or death.
WARNING
Improper installation, adjustment, alteration, service
or maintenance can cause property damage, person-
al injury or loss of life. Installation and service must
be performed by a licensed professional installer (or
equivalent), service agency or the gas supplier.
CAUTION
As with any mechanical equipment, personal injury
can result from contact with sharp sheet metal
edges. Be careful when you handle this equipment.

Page 4 ML180UH Gas Furnace The ML180UH unit is shipped ready for installation in theupflow or horizontal right position (for horizontal left posi-tion the combustion air pressure switch must be moved).The furnace is shipped with the bottom panel in place.
